Output 6986418b4bdfa7eb5fdfd41cfef8fac199b234bb4a5e7ed8f68de9def6cc008a:0

value
138510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a7c545a0d7258c31cdabdf87b87aa293a615ed OP_EQUAL
address
3NuBfxGEQqZuhU1vPaNucwUKniy3qcQqx7
transaction
6986418b4bdfa7eb5fdfd41cfef8fac199b234bb4a5e7ed8f68de9def6cc008a
confirmations
313004
spent
true